Invesco China Technology ETF
CQQQ
CQQQ
79 hedge funds and large institutions have $120M invested in Invesco China Technology ETF in 2022 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 9 funds opening new positions, 16 increasing their positions, 32 reducing their positions, and 12 closing their positions.
